TitlePostcard from D.H. Lawrence, Papeete, Tahiti to Ada Clarke; 22 August 1922

Custodial HistoryThis item was purchased with support from the Hill endowment and added to the D.H. Lawrence Collection in March 2021.
Content DescriptionA postcard from Lawrence sent to his sister Ada Clarke from Tahiti. On the verso of a colourised photograph of a male Tahitian wearing red loincloth and carrying a green palm leaf, Lawrence writes 'Sail on tomorrow afternoon - hot - lovely island - but town spoilt - don't really want to stay. But having a very good trip. Love DHL'. A postscript in an unknown hand reads 'Saluti tanti al Postino Salvatore' ('Many greetings to Postman Salvatore').

ConditionSize 138 x 88 mm.
Postcard. Recto, colourised photograph of a male Tahitian wearing red loincloth and carrying a green palm leaf. Postcard titled 'A Tahitian'.
Verso, black manuscript ink. There is discolouration where a postage stamp used previously to be affixed. There is a postmark, 'Papeete 23-8 22'.
Publication NoteWarren Roberts, James T. Boulton and Elizabeth Mansfield, eds. ‘'The Letters of D.H. Lawrence' (Cambridge: Cambridge University Press, 1987) Vol IV, p 285
